https://bugzilla.novell.com/show_bug.cgi?id=469332 Summary: Running a ".jar" file seems to do nothing Classification: openSUSE Product: openSUSE 11.1 Version: Final Platform: Other OS/Version: Other Status: NEW Severity: Normal Priority: P5 - None Component: Java AssignedTo: bnc-team-java@forge.provo.novell.com ReportedBy: noelamac@gmail.com QAContact: qa@suse.de Found By: --- openSUSE 11.1 (32 bits) installed on VirtualBox, Gnome desktop, Sun's Java 1.6 When I try to run a ".jar" file, I get a small window terminal and then it closes itself. The Java application does not open. Running the same ".jar" file in gnome-terminal ("java -jar app.jar") it just runs fine. Gnome's jar file association calls to "/usr/bin/jarwrapper" to open this kind of files, which fails. Changing the path to "/usr/bin/java -jar" the program can be started. -- Configure bugmail: https://bugzilla.novell.com/userprefs.cgi?tab=email ------- You are receiving this mail because: ------- You are on the CC list for the bug.
